Canada is signatory to International Covenant on Economic, Social and Cultural Rights which does recongise housing as right and early in his first term Trudau affirmed the commitment (even if it's not in constitutional right).

I think it becomes a murkier issue what 'housing' is. Is it the right to live within four walls and not on the street or being able to afford a four bedroom house and den within an hours drive of a major city?

Itís not a right unless itís in law and been upheld by courts.  Trudeau signing something may be aspirational, but itís  not a right. 

Clearly, no one has any right to a home in Canada.  If youíre homeless, there may be shelters and such, but the government isnít even obligated to house you in any way. 
